Traumatic injuries, whether from a car accident, a sports collision, or a serious fall, can have devastating consequences for internal organs. The likelihood and type of organ injury depend on several factors, including the organ's location, composition, and vascularity. Solid, dense organs are highly susceptible to crushing forces, while hollow organs react differently to sudden pressure changes.

The Vulnerability of Solid Abdominal Organs

Solid organs are particularly prone to injury in blunt trauma because they are dense and have a rich blood supply. When subjected to crushing or rapid deceleration, these organs can tear or bleed profusely, leading to massive and life-threatening internal hemorrhage.

Spleen

The spleen is widely recognized as one of the most susceptible organs to traumatic injury, especially following blunt force to the left upper abdomen. Its delicate capsule and soft tissue structure make it prone to lacerations and rupture, which can result in significant internal bleeding. Factors increasing its risk include:

  • Location: Positioned just under the left rib cage, it is easily compressed and torn by a severe blow.
  • Vascularity: A dense network of blood vessels means a small tear can cause rapid blood loss.
  • Enlargement: A spleen enlarged by conditions like infectious mononucleosis is exceptionally fragile and can rupture with even minor trauma.

Liver

As the largest abdominal organ, the liver is the most commonly injured abdominal organ overall, often affected by both blunt and penetrating trauma.

  • Large Size: Its sheer size makes it an expansive target for traumatic force.
  • Fragile Tissue: The liver's delicate parenchyma and thin capsule mean it can lacerate or develop a subcapsular hematoma from impact.
  • Blood Flow: With dual blood supply and high volume, liver injury carries a significant risk of severe bleeding.

Kidneys

The kidneys, located in the retroperitoneal space on either side of the spine, are also vulnerable to traumatic forces, especially from motor vehicle accidents and falls.

  • Crush Injury: They can be compressed and injured against the rigid vertebral column.
  • Deceleration: Sudden stops can cause the kidney's vascular pedicle or ureteropelvic junction to tear, leading to bleeding and urine leakage.
  • Pre-existing Conditions: Abnormalities like hydronephrosis make the kidneys even more susceptible to injury from less significant forces.

Hollow vs. Solid Organ Vulnerability

Solid and hollow organs face different types of risks during trauma, which is critical for emergency providers to understand. While solid organs are at high risk of hemorrhage, hollow organs pose a risk of infection from spilled contents.

Feature Solid Organs (Spleen, Liver, Kidneys) Hollow Organs (Stomach, Intestines, Bladder)
Primary Risk Profuse bleeding (hemorrhage) Rupture and spillage of contents (infection/sepsis)
Injury Mechanism Crushing or shearing forces Sudden internal pressure increase
Vulnerability Factors Fragile tissue, high vascularity Contains air/fluid, less common in blunt trauma unless distended
Associated Injuries Commonly involved in blunt trauma Often associated with severe, multi-organ injuries

The Pancreas: A Deep and Dangerous Injury

While less common than spleen or liver injuries, pancreatic trauma is notoriously difficult to diagnose and can have severe, delayed complications. Its deep location protects it from many impacts, but a forceful blow to the epigastrium can crush it against the spine. A ruptured pancreatic duct can lead to chemical peritonitis, abscess formation, and other life-threatening issues that may not manifest for days or even weeks.

The Special Case of the Brain

Although not an abdominal organ, the brain is among the most important and vulnerable organs to injury, even from minor forces. Traumatic brain injury (TBI) can result from direct impact, rapid acceleration-deceleration, or other violent motion that causes the brain to strike the inside of the skull.

  • Mechanism: The brain's soft tissue moving within the rigid skull can cause bruising, tearing of blood vessels (hematomas), and diffuse axonal injury.
  • Vulnerability: TBI can result from forces that seem insignificant, and its effects can range from temporary to permanent neurological damage.

Recognizing and Responding to Potential Internal Injury

Because the signs of internal injury can be subtle or delayed, it is essential to seek immediate medical help after any significant trauma, particularly to the torso or head. Symptoms like abdominal pain, bruising, unexplained lightheadedness, or signs of shock (e.g., pale, clammy skin) should never be ignored. Modern medicine utilizes advanced imaging, such as contrast-enhanced CT scans, to diagnose internal injuries and guide the most appropriate treatment, which often involves careful observation rather than immediate surgery.
